Apparent - Významy

obvious or easily seen; clearly visible or understood

Příklad: It was apparent that she was upset by the look on her face.
Použití: formalKontext: academic writing, professional reports
Poznámka: This meaning is commonly used in formal contexts to indicate something that is clearly evident or obvious.

seeming real or true, but not necessarily so; appearing to be true but not necessarily the case

Příklad: His apparent lack of interest in the project was misleading; he was actually very engaged behind the scenes.
Použití: formalKontext: legal documents, scientific research
Poznámka: This meaning suggests that something appears to be a certain way but may not be the actual truth.

readily visible or understood; able to be seen or perceived

Příklad: The apparent simplicity of the task masked its underlying complexity.
Použití: formal/informalKontext: everyday conversations, technical discussions
Poznámka: This meaning can be used in both formal and informal contexts to describe something that is easily noticeable or understood upon closer examination.

Synonyma Apparent

evident

Evident means easily seen or understood; clearly visible or obvious.
Příklad: Her exhaustion was evident from the dark circles under her eyes.
Poznámka: Evident is often used to describe something that is clearly perceivable or noticeable without much effort.

obvious

Obvious means easily perceived or understood; clear, apparent, or plain.
Příklad: The answer to the problem was obvious once he explained it.
Poznámka: Obvious often implies that something is easily seen or understood without the need for further explanation.

clear

Clear means easily perceived, understood, or detected; not vague or ambiguous.
Příklad: His intentions were clear from the way he spoke.
Poznámka: Clear is used to describe something that is easily comprehensible or transparent in meaning.

manifest

Manifest means clearly apparent to the sight, understanding, or mind; evident; obvious.
Příklad: The effects of climate change are manifest in the extreme weather patterns we are experiencing.
Poznámka: Manifest is often used to describe something that is clearly evident or perceptible.

Apparent každodenní (slangové) výrazy

Seemingly

Seemingly is used to express that something appears to be a certain way based on initial impressions.
Příklad: His success was seemingly overnight, but it actually took years of hard work.
Poznámka: Seemingly implies that the appearance may not necessarily reflect the reality of the situation.

Ostensibly

Ostensibly is used to indicate that something is stated or appearing to be true, though its actual purpose or intention may be different.
Příklad: The company's decision to cut costs was ostensibly to increase efficiency, but it led to lower quality in their products.
Poznámka: Ostensibly suggests that there may be hidden motives or explanations behind the apparent situation.

Evidently

Evidently is used to indicate that something is clear or obvious based on available evidence or observation.
Příklad: Evidently, she had not read the memo because she was unaware of the meeting's cancellation.
Poznámka: Evidently emphasizes the clarity or obviousness of the situation based on available information.

Supposedly

Supposedly is used to suggest that something is believed to be true or claimed by others, even though there may be doubts or uncertainties.
Příklad: The movie is supposedly based on a true story, but many details have been altered for dramatic effect.
Poznámka: Supposedly highlights that the information or belief is based on claims or beliefs rather than definitive evidence.

Allegedly

Allegedly is used to convey that something is claimed to have happened or been done, often in a legal context, without proof or confirmation.
Příklad: The suspect allegedly stole a car, but there is no concrete evidence linking him to the crime.
Poznámka: Allegedly indicates that the information is based on claims or accusations without verified evidence.

Presumably

Presumably is used to express an assumption based on what is known or likely to be true.
Příklad: He's not here yet, so presumably, he got stuck in traffic.
Poznámka: Presumably suggests that the assumption is made based on logical reasoning or past experience rather than direct evidence.

Reportedly

Reportedly is used to indicate that something is said to be true, often based on sources or reports, without personal verification.
Příklad: The product reportedly contains harmful chemicals, according to the latest study.
Poznámka: Reportedly highlights that the information is based on what others have claimed or reported, rather than personal knowledge or observation.
